Is This American Soldier Patient Zero For COVID-19?
A video of an American soldier smearing his saliva on a train pole is circulating on social media, accompanied by this message :
Just to share this clip and its comments from China:
The surveillance cameras in Wuhan have a road map of the US soldiers and a video record of the time.
The American soldier had put on a mask during the military games. Began to spread the epidemic virus by subway.
If you look at the movement of that hand carefully, from the mouth to the armrest, you will know the evil and evil heart of Americans.
Poor Wuhan citizens are infected with the ruthless epidemic virus. ☝☝☝
The message implies that the Chinese have determined that Patient Zero is an American soldier who attended the 2019 Military World Games that was held in Wuhan, China from 18 to 27 October 2019.
It also implies that the Americans brought COVID-19 to Wuhan, and used one of their soldiers to spread it to the Chinese. And the video is the evidence.
Even the Chinese Foreign Ministry’s spokesperson Zhao Lijian pushed the same fake claim, saying, “When did patient zero begin in the US? It might be the US army who brought the epidemic to Wuhan!”
Well, all that is HOGWASH. Let us show you why…
American Soldier On Train Is Patient Zero Hoax Debunked!
The truth is the video was recorded on 9 March 2020 in a Belgian subway, not October 2019 in Wuhan.
The man in the video was not an American soldier, but an intoxicated Belgian who licked his finger and rubbed it on the subway pole.
He was later arrested for doing that, and the train removed and disinfected.
